What is SAED?

SAED, a strategic initiative embedded within the NYSC orientation program, stands for Skills Acquisition and Entrepreneurship Development. Its primary purpose is to empower corps members with practical skills and entrepreneurial know-how, fostering self-reliance and job creation.

This targeted approach aims to address Nigeria’s youth unemployment challenge while simultaneously promoting economic development by cultivating a skilled and entrepreneurial workforce.

SAED Activities during NYSC Orientation

The NYSC orientation camp isn’t just about drills and parades; it’s also a launchpad for future success. A crucial component of this experience is the Skills Acquisition and Entrepreneurship Development (SAED) program, designed to empower corps members with the tools and knowledge to become self-reliant and contribute meaningfully to the economy.

1. Seeding the Entrepreneurial Mindset:

  • Sensitization and Mobilization: The SAED program starts by raising awareness about its benefits and potential. Informative sessions and interactive activities show how acquiring skills and developing entrepreneurial ventures can unlock possibilities, paving the way for financial independence and career fulfilment. This initial stage encourages active participation from corps members, igniting their entrepreneurial spirit.

2. Exploring a World of Skills:

  • Skill Acquisition Training: The program offers diverse skill areas to cater to various interests and talents. From agriculture and ICT to fashion design and catering, corps members are exposed to many options. They gain hands-on experience and a deeper understanding of each skill through practical demonstrations and interactive workshops. This crucial phase lets them identify their preferred skill and embark on a focused learning journey.

3. Building the Business Acumen:

  • Entrepreneurship Development Workshops: Beyond technical skills, SAED equips corps members with the foundational knowledge needed to navigate the business world. Workshops delve into crucial business concepts like market research, financial planning, and marketing strategies. Corps members develop essential entrepreneurial skills such as communication, problem-solving, and negotiation, empowering them to make informed decisions and navigate challenges effectively. Additionally, these workshops encourage exploring business opportunities and generating innovative ideas that can translate into successful ventures.

Post-Orientation SAED Opportunities

Beyond the initial orientation, SAED offers a robust online platform called SAEDConnect. This platform is your one-stop shop for continued learning and development, equipping you with the tools and resources necessary to thrive in your chosen field. Here’s what you can expect:

  1. Continued Learning: Access a vast library of online courses, tutorials, and webinars to deepen your knowledge and refine your skills. Stay updated on industry trends and advancements to remain competitive.
  2. Mentorship: Connect with experienced professionals and entrepreneurs who can provide valuable guidance and support and share their insights. Gain invaluable mentorship to navigate challenges and accelerate your entrepreneurial journey.
  3. Business Tools and Funding: Unlock a treasure trove of resources, including business plan templates, marketing materials, and financial planning tools. Explore funding opportunities through grants, loans, and investors listed on the platform.
  4. Networking Community: Connect with fellow corps members, entrepreneurs, and industry experts to build a strong network. Collaborate, share ideas, and forge valuable partnerships to propel your business forward.

Frequently Asked Questions

What skills are offered in SAED?

SAED offers a wide range of skills in various sectors, including agriculture, fashion, ICT, beauty, and more. You can explore the specific skills offered at your orientation camp.

Is SAED mandatory?

Participating in SAED workshops and attending sessions is mandatory during orientation, but choosing a specific skill for training is optional.

How do I choose a skill for training?

Consider your interests, career aspirations, and existing skills when choosing a training option. You can also attend introductory workshops during orientation to understand different skills better.

What happens after I choose a skill?

After choosing a skill, you will receive training from experienced professionals and have the opportunity to practice what you learn.

Can I participate in SAED after orientation?

Yes, you can continue learning and developing your chosen skill even after orientation. SAEDConnect, the online platform, offers resources and opportunities for further skill development and entrepreneurship support.

Who can I contact if I have questions about SAED?

You can contact the SAED officials at your orientation camp or visit the NYSC SAED department website for more information.

What are the benefits of participating in SAED?

SAED provides valuable skills that can enhance your employability and equip you with the knowledge and confidence to start your own business.

Does SAED offer any financial support for entrepreneurship?

While SAED doesn’t directly offer financial support, they can connect you with resources and organizations that offer funding opportunities for small businesses.

What is SAEDConnect?

SAEDConnect is an online platform designed to support NYSC Corps Members in their skill development and entrepreneurial endeavors. It provides resources, training modules, mentorship opportunities, and connects you with other aspiring entrepreneurs.
